Team Lead, MaintenancePosition SummaryThe Team Lead, Maintenance is responsible for leading a team of maintenance technicians while ensuring the safe, reliable, and efficient operation of manufacturing equipment and facility systems. This role provides daily leadership, coordinates preventive and corrective maintenance, develops team capability, drives continuous improvement, and partners with Operations, Engineering, HS&E, and Quality to maximize equipment uptime and support production goals. The Team Lead balances hands-on technical expertise with people leadership, accountability, and execution of the Watlow Business System.
Key Responsibilities- Lead, coach, develop, and hold accountable a team of Maintenance Technicians.
- Plan and prioritize daily maintenance activities to minimize equipment downtime.
- Drive preventive and predictive maintenance strategies using CMMS.
- Lead troubleshooting and root cause analysis of equipment failures.
- Partner with Operations, Manufacturing Engineering, Quality, and HS&E to improve equipment reliability and safety.
- Monitor maintenance KPIs including uptime, PM completion, MTTR, and work order backlog.
- Support capital projects, equipment installations, and process improvements.
- Maintain spare parts inventory and maintenance documentation.
- Promote Watlow Values, leadership competencies, and continuous improvement.
Leadership Responsibilities- Conduct performance coaching, training, and development.
- Support staffing, onboarding, scheduling, and succession planning.
- Lead daily tier meetings and communicate priorities.
- Ensure compliance with Watlow policies.
Qualifications- Associate degree in Industrial Maintenance, Mechatronics, Engineering Technology, or related field preferred; equivalent experience considered.
- 5+ years of industrial maintenance experience.
- 2+ years of leadership experience preferred.
- Strong knowledge of m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, pneumatic, PLC, and automation systems.
- Experience with CMMS and Lean/continuous improvement preferred.
Physical RequirementsWork is performed in a manufacturing environment and includes standing, walking, lifting up to 50 pounds with assistance as needed, exposure to industrial noise and temperature variations, and occasional off-shift support.
